* [PATCH] irqchip/mst-intc: reject ranges beyond saved state capacity

The inclusive Device Tree IRQ range determines nr_irqs. Suspend and
resume then use nr_irqs to walk the fixed saved_status array, which has
MST_INTC_MAX_IRQS entries. A descending range underflows the unsigned
subtraction, while a range wider than 64 entries exceeds that array.

Reject both forms before deriving nr_irqs.

 drivers/irqchip/irq-mst-intc.c | 4 ++++
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/irqchip/irq-mst-intc.c b/drivers/irqchip/irq-mst-intc.c
index b5335f6fd6d6..1475335d668d 100644
--- a/drivers/irqchip/irq-mst-intc.c
+++ b/drivers/irqchip/irq-mst-intc.c
@@ -263,6 +263,10 @@ static int __init mst_intc_of_init(struct device_node *dn,
 	    of_property_read_u32_index(dn, "mstar,irqs-map-range", 1, &irq_end))
 		return -EINVAL;
 
+	if (irq_end < irq_start ||
+	    irq_end - irq_start >= MST_INTC_MAX_IRQS)
+		return -EINVAL;
+
 	cd = kzalloc_obj(*cd);
 	if (!cd)
 		return -ENOMEM;
